We are seeking to appoint a Postdoctoral Research Associate to join the translational Lymphoma Immunology group led by Dr Alan G. Ramsay. The group aims to identify effective combination immunotherapy and mechanisms of action within the tumour microenvironment/TME. In addition, we study and model the role of fibroblasts and endothelial cells within lymphoid tissue TMEs, as well as clinical trial-associated biomarker and bioassay studies to help advance the design of future therapies for patients.   


Immunotherapy response rates have been disappointingly low in many B cell malignancies that develop within lymphoid tissues (chronic lymphocytic leukaemia, diffuse large B-cell lymphoma). This has highlighted the need to understand immunosuppressive mechanisms within these tumours (TMEs). King's College London is one of the top 20 universities in the world and among the oldest in England. King's has more than 27,600 students (of whom nearly 10,500 are graduate students) from some 150 countries worldwide, and some 6,800 staff.

King's has an outstanding reputation for world-class teaching and cutting-edge research. In the 2014 Research Excellence Framework (REF) King’s was ranked 6th nationally in the ‘power’ ranking, which takes into account both the quality and quantity of research activity, and 7th for quality according to Times Higher Education rankings. Eighty-four per cent of research at King’s was deemed ‘world-leading’ or ‘internationally excellent’ (3* and 4*). The university is in the top seven UK universities for research earnings and has an overall annual income of more than £684 million.

King's has a particularly distinguished reputation in the humanities, law, the sciences (including a wide range of health areas such as psychiatry, medicine, nursing and dentistry) and social sciences including international affairs. It has played a major role in many of the advances that have shaped modern life, such as the discovery of the structure of DNA and research that led to the development of radio, television, mobile phones and radar.
